Virginia legislation enables no-blame divorce or separation due to (a) life style “independent and you may apart” for just one 12 months otherwise (b) life separate and you can apart to possess 6 months which have a separation agreement in position with no lesser youngsters.
In the place of of several says, Virginia doesn’t always have an approach to getting a position out-of “judge separation” during these no-fault instances. Meaning, divorcing partners inside the Virginia always move from being married, so you’re able to life style apart (which have or versus a breakup contract), of having a breakup-which have a court just taking involved at separation and divorce stage. There is not a meantime stage in which good Virginia court features new functions the fresh new status out of “legitimately broke up.”
The fresh new nearest matter Virginia has to the type of judge separation supplied by the most other states is one thing called an excellent “separation and divorce out of sleep and board,” that’s limited to fault-depending circumstances and extremely hardly supplied for the Virginia.
Traditions Separate and Aside
Therefore, what does they imply to call home “separate and you can aside” to own purposes of a splitting up into separation crushed from inside the Virginia? It fundamentally means two things: (1) bodily break up with (2) at least one people acquiring the intent that the breakup will feel long lasting.
- Bodily Separation. Real break up can be attained by one-party venturing out off the latest marital quarters. However, Virginia laws do enable it to be spouses to reside e rooftop for purposes of their six- otherwise several-week break up several months. You’ll find most tight recommendations because of it techniques. To find out more, see in-Home Separation into the Virginia.
- Intention. Among the people should have decided that wedding are over and you may conveyed that facts to their companion. Sometimes this is accomplished because of the a text or a message, but almost always there is only a discussion. It is advisable to file this because of the stating new purpose in order to forever stop the wedding (at the time of a particular big date) in writing.
Demonstrating the fresh go out out-of separation was a factual dedication, so that the courts will need a global facts so you can corroborate the day away from breakup. To find out more, get a hold of Establishing Go out off Break up during the a great Virginia Breakup.

Desertion against. Breakup
How does you to definitely real time “independent and you can aside” in order to be eligible for a zero-blame breakup, without having to be found guilty away from willful desertion, that is a failing-founded surface having divorce? Virginia courts differentiate desertion regarding separation by looking at the specific behavior of your own events. Process of law keeps constantly discovered that one party heading out of your own relationship bed room or the relationship home cannot itself reveal that an excellent desertion features taken place. Instead, a finding of desertion requires that one party has actually stopped undertaking their marital responsibilities, that can become however they are not restricted so you can delivering capital or adding to marital costs or bills, and you can delivering psychological or bodily service.
Break up, while the prominent away from desertion, are separating from your spouse, in both the home otherwise exterior, when you find yourself however working within the regulations and you may requirements of wedding, such as department of relationship loans and you will commitments.
